Uramanoa Bay
Uramanoa Bay is an inlet in Oro Province, Papua New Guinea. Uramanoa Bay is situated nearby to the locality Siu, as well as near Orotoaba.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Tufi
Photo: Heavydpj,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Tufi is a small town on the northeast coast of Papua New Guinea in the area known as the Fjordland of PNG, The area has spectacular scenery and is also famous for its production of tapa, a decorated cloth produced from the bark of the paper mulberry tree, which is also found in Tonga, Samoa and Fiji.
